While Harry and Meghan are trying to avoid royal controversies, they have created some on their own in the US. The last one just happened, and it involved Harry accepting an award.

Harry received the Pat Tillman Award for Service at the 2024 ESPY Awards.
Prince Harry labeled “controversial and divisive” after accepting an award
ESPY said Harry was honored for his “tireless work in making a positive impact for the veteran community through the power of sport” with the Invictus Games he created years ago. The award has previously been given to unsung heroes – but the fact that Prince Harry got it this year doesn’t sit well with everyone.
Pat Tillman was a US soldier killed in Afghanistan, for whom the award has been named. Now, his mother, Mary, criticizes Harry for getting it in the first place.
“I am shocked as to why they would select such a controversial and divisive individual to receive the award. Some recipients are far more fitting. There are individuals working in the veteran community that are doing tremendous things to assist veterans,” she told the Daily Mail.
“These individuals do not have the money, resources, connections or privilege that Prince Harry has. I feel that those types of individuals should be recognised.”
A spokesman for ESPY answered, ‘”While we understand not everyone will agree with all honourees selected for any award, The Invictus Games Foundation does incredible work, and ESPN believes this is a cause worth celebrating.”
